4 years ago[DebugInfo] Call site entries cannot be generated for FrameSetup calls
lewis-revill [Tue, 11 Feb 2020 21:23:18 +0000 (21:23 +0000)]
[DebugInfo] Call site entries cannot be generated for FrameSetup calls

Instructions marked as FrameSetup do not cause requestLabelAfterInsn to
be called and so no such label is generated. Call instructions which
require call site entries to be generated require this label to be
present in order to calculate the return PC offset/address, but the
check for whether the call instruction is marked as FrameSetup was not
present.

Therefore in the case where a call instruction is marked as FrameSetup,
an assertion failure occurs if a call site entry is to be generated.
This is the case with RISC-V's implementation of save/restore via
library calls.

4 years ago[RISCV] Add support for save/restore of callee-saved registers via libcalls
lewis-revill [Tue, 11 Feb 2020 21:23:03 +0000 (21:23 +0000)]
[RISCV] Add support for save/restore of callee-saved registers via libcalls

This patch adds the support required for using the __riscv_save and
__riscv_restore libcalls to implement a size-optimization for prologue
and epilogue code, whereby the spill and restore code of callee-saved
registers is implemented by common functions to reduce code duplication.

Logic is also included to ensure that if both this optimization and
shrink wrapping are enabled then the prologue and epilogue code can be
safely inserted into the basic blocks chosen by shrink wrapping.

4 years ago[ORC] Fix symbol dependence propagation algorithm in ObjectLinkingLayer.
Lang Hames [Tue, 11 Feb 2020 17:02:22 +0000 (09:02 -0800)]
[ORC] Fix symbol dependence propagation algorithm in ObjectLinkingLayer.

ObjectLinkingLayer was not correctly propagating dependencies through local
symbols within an object. This could cause symbol lookup to return before a
searched-for symbol is ready if the following conditions are met:
(1) The definition of the symbol being searched for transitively depends on a
    local symbol within the same object, and that local symbol in turn
    transitively depends on an external symbol provided by some other module
    in the JIT.
(2) Concurrent compilation is enabled.
(3) Thread scheduling causes the lookup of the searched-for symbol to return
    before all transitive dependencies of the looked-up symbol are emitted.

This bug was found by inspection and has not been observed in practice.

A jitlink test case has been added to verify that symbol dependencies are
correctly propagated through local symbol definitions.

4 years ago[OPENMP50]Full handling of atomic_default_mem_order in requires
Alexey Bataev [Tue, 11 Feb 2020 20:15:21 +0000 (15:15 -0500)]
[OPENMP50]Full handling of atomic_default_mem_order in requires
directive.

According to OpenMP 5.0, The atomic_default_mem_order clause specifies the default memory ordering behavior for atomic constructs that must be provided by an implementation. If the default memory ordering is specified as seq_cst, all atomic constructs on which memory-order-clause is not specified behave as if the seq_cst clause appears. If the default memory ordering is specified as relaxed, all atomic constructs on which memory-order-clause is not specified behave as if the relaxed clause appears.
If the default memory ordering is specified as acq_rel, atomic constructs on which memory-order-clause is not specified behave as if the release clause appears if the atomic write or atomic update operation is specified, as if the acquire clause appears if the atomic read operation is specified, and as if the acq_rel clause appears if the atomic captured update operation is specified.

4 years agoAllow retrieving source files relative to the compilation directory.
Sterling Augustine [Fri, 24 Jan 2020 22:36:22 +0000 (14:36 -0800)]
Allow retrieving source files relative to the compilation directory.

Summary:
Dwarf stores source-file names the three parts:
<compilation_directory><include_directory><filename>

Prior to this change, the code only allowed retrieving either all
three as the absolute path, or just the filename.  But many
compile-command lines--especially those in hermetic build systems
don't specify an absolute path, nor just the filename, but rather the
path relative to the compilation directory. This features allows
retrieving them in that style.

4 years ago[BPF] implement isTruncateFree and isZExtFree in BPFTargetLowering
Yonghong Song [Wed, 5 Feb 2020 18:27:43 +0000 (10:27 -0800)]
[BPF] implement isTruncateFree and isZExtFree in BPFTargetLowering

Currently, isTruncateFree() and isZExtFree() callbacks return false
as they are not implemented in BPF backend. This may cause suboptimal
code generation. For example, if the load in the context of zero extension
has more than one use, the pattern zextload{i8,i16,i32} will
not be generated. Rather, the load will be matched first and
then the result is zero extended.

For example, in the test together with this commit, we have
   I1: %0 = load i32, i32* %data_end1, align 4, !tbaa !2
   I2: %conv = zext i32 %0 to i64
   ...
   I3: %2 = load i32, i32* %data, align 4, !tbaa !7
   I4: %conv2 = zext i32 %2 to i64
   ...
   I5: %4 = trunc i64 %sub.ptr.lhs.cast to i32
   I6: %conv13 = sub i32 %4, %2
   ...

The I1 and I2 will match to one zextloadi32 DAG node, where SUBREG_TO_REG is
used to convert a 32bit register to 64bit one. During code generation,
SUBREG_TO_REG is a noop.

The %2 in I3 is used in both I4 and I6. If isTruncateFree() is false,
the current implementation will generate a SLL_ri and SRL_ri
for the zext part during lowering.

This patch implement isTruncateFree() in the BPF backend, so for the
above example, I3 and I4 will generate a zextloadi32 DAG node with
SUBREG_TO_REG is generated during lowering to Machine IR.

isZExtFree() is also implemented as it should help code gen as well.

4 years ago[DirectoryWatcher] Fix misuse of FSEvents API and data race
Ben Langmuir [Tue, 11 Feb 2020 01:22:52 +0000 (17:22 -0800)]
[DirectoryWatcher] Fix misuse of FSEvents API and data race

I observed two bugs in the DirectoryWatcher on macOS

1. We were calling FSEventStreamStop and FSEventStreamInvalidate before
we called FSEventStreamStart and FSEventStreamSetDispatchQueue, if the
DirectoryWatcher was destroyed before the initial async work was done.
This violates the requirements of the FSEvents API.

2. Calls to Receiver could race between the initial work and the
invalidation during destruction.

The second issue is easier to see when using TSan.

4 years ago[X86CmovConversion] Make heuristic for optimized cmov depth more conservative (PR44539)
Nikita Popov [Thu, 6 Feb 2020 20:16:10 +0000 (21:16 +0100)]
[X86CmovConversion] Make heuristic for optimized cmov depth more conservative (PR44539)

Fix/workaround for https://bugs.llvm.org/show_bug.cgi?id=44539.
As discussed there, this pass makes some overly optimistic
assumptions, as it does not have access to actual branch weights.

This patch makes the computation of the depth of the optimized cmov
more conservative, by assuming a distribution of 75/25 rather than
50/50 and placing the weights to get the more conservative result
(larger depth). The fully conservative choice would be
std::max(TrueOpDepth, FalseOpDepth), but that would break at least
one existing test (which may or may not be an issue in practice).

4 years agoUse C++14-style return type deduction in LLVM.
Justin Lebar [Mon, 10 Feb 2020 23:49:14 +0000 (15:49 -0800)]
Use C++14-style return type deduction in LLVM.

Summary:
Simplifies the C++11-style "-> decltype(...)" return-type deduction.

Note that you have to be careful about whether the function return type
is `auto` or `decltype(auto)`.  The difference is that bare `auto`
strips const and reference, just like lambda return type deduction.  In
some cases that's what we want (or more likely, we know that the return
type is a value type), but whenever we're wrapping a templated function
which might return a reference, we need to be sure that the return type
is decltype(auto).

No functional change.

4 years ago[OPENMP50]Add restrictions for memory order clauses in atomic directive.
Alexey Bataev [Tue, 11 Feb 2020 14:35:52 +0000 (09:35 -0500)]
[OPENMP50]Add restrictions for memory order clauses in atomic directive.

Added restrictions for atomic directive.
1. If atomic-clause is read then memory-order-clause must not be acq_rel or release.
2. If atomic-clause is write then memory-order-clause must not be
   acq_rel or acquire.
3. If atomic-clause is update or not present then memory-order-clause
   must not be acq_rel or acquire.

4 years ago[lldb] Delete the SharingPtr class
Pavel Labath [Tue, 4 Feb 2020 02:05:21 +0000 (18:05 -0800)]
[lldb] Delete the SharingPtr class

Summary:
The only use of this class was to implement the SharedCluster of ValueObjects.
However, the same functionality can be implemented using a regular
std::shared_ptr, and its little-known "sub-object pointer" feature, where the
pointer can point to one thing, but actually delete something else when it goes
out of scope.

This patch reimplements SharedCluster using this feature --
SharedClusterPointer::GetObject now returns a std::shared_pointer which points
to the ValueObject, but actually owns the whole cluster. The only change I
needed to make here is that now the SharedCluster object needs to be created
before the root ValueObject. This means that all private ValueObject
constructors get a ClusterManager argument, and their static Create functions do
the create-a-manager-and-pass-it-to-value-object dance.

4 years ago[DebugInfo] Teach LDV how to handle identical variable fragments
OCHyams [Tue, 11 Feb 2020 09:44:32 +0000 (09:44 +0000)]
[DebugInfo] Teach LDV how to handle identical variable fragments

LiveDebugVariables uses interval maps to explicitly represent DBG_VALUE
intervals. DBG_VALUEs are filtered into an interval map based on their {
Variable, DIExpression }. The interval map will coalesce adjacent entries that
use the same { Location }.  Under this model, DBG_VALUEs which refer to the same
bits of the same variable will be filtered into different interval maps if they
have different DIExpressions which means the original intervals will not be
properly preserved.

This patch fixes the problem by using { Variable, Fragment } to filter the
DBG_VALUEs into maps, and coalesces adjacent entries iff they have the same
{ Location, DIExpression } pair.

The solution is not perfect because we see the similar issues appear when
partially overlapping fragments are encountered, but is far simpler than a
complete solution (i.e. D70121).
